Tag: Grand Canyon National Park
March 30, 2025
Blog, Destinations, Destinations, USA
Grand Canyon National Park: A Must-See Natural Wonder
Grand Canyon National Park is one of the most iconic natural wonders in the world, attracting over six million visitors…